In refactors during PM4, I stripped out packet buffer caching, as it was problematic when events alter packets in undetectable ways. However, I never cleaned this part of the code up properly after enabling DataPacketSendEvent to include multiple packets and multiple targets, so we were still individually encoding the packet(s) for every single session if the sum total of the sizes was below 256 bytes. This change encodes packets once in the StandardPacketBroadcaster and retains their buffers to post to the session's send buffer directly if the resulting batch is below compression threshold. This code is still not optimal (see ##5589), but fixing this brings broadcasting performance back to PM3 levels, without any of PM3's problems.
